Key Evaluation Criteria for Remittance Apps
When searching for the best remittance app for sending money from Singapore to Malaysia, there are several key criteria that users should consider:
- Speed: Fast transfers are a top priority, as recipients in Malaysia often need the money quickly. Many services offer instant or same-day transfers.
- Fees: Low transaction fees are essential for maximizing the amount received by the recipient. Users typically prefer platforms with transparent fee structures.
- FX Rates: Competitive exchange rates are vital, as the value of the Malaysian Ringgit (MYR) can fluctuate against the Singapore Dollar (SGD).
- Payment Methods: Multiple payment options, including bank transfers, PayNow, and mobile wallets, are important for flexibility and convenience.
- Security: Security is a major consideration, as users want to ensure that their funds are transferred safely and securely.
